Hotmail

Featured Replies

Has anyone had a problem with hotmail in box??? every time I go to the in-box everything is in block style and I have to use the refresh to get it back to normal any ideas on how to fix this problem?

Thank You

  • Author
What browser are you using? Do mean that Thai script is in blocked letter?

No the english it appears such as "inbox, junk, ect in blue block letters

I had the same problem yesterday, just a sort of unformatted page with the various Folder titles in blue block letters.

It seemed as though the page had not fully loaded, but a "refresh" and the problem cleared and has not re-occurred.

Patrick

This has happened to me many times over the years. As the other posters said, just refresh the page. It seems to only happen if the page loads slowly.

Try to clear your cache, you might have a corrupted style sheet stored.
